Understanding Angina: The Core Problem
Before diving into medication choices, it’s crucial to grasp what angina is and why it occurs. Angina pectoris, commonly known as angina, is chest pain or discomfort that arises when your heart muscle doesn’t receive enough oxygen-rich blood. This imbalance between oxygen supply and demand is usually a symptom of underlying coronary artery disease (CAD), where the arteries supplying blood to the heart become narrowed and hardened due to plaque buildup (atherosclerosis).
Angina can manifest in various forms:
- Stable Angina: This is the most common type, typically triggered by predictable physical exertion or emotional stress. The pain is usually relieved by rest or nitroglycerin.
-
Unstable Angina: This is a medical emergency. It’s unpredictable, occurring even at rest, is more severe, lasts longer, and doesn’t respond to usual angina medications. It signals a heightened risk of a heart attack.
-
Variant Angina (Prinzmetal’s Angina): Less common, this type is caused by a spasm in the coronary arteries, temporarily reducing blood flow. It often occurs at rest, particularly overnight.
-
Refractory Angina: This refers to chronic, severe angina that persists despite optimal medical therapy and revascularization procedures.
The primary goals of angina medication are twofold: to alleviate symptoms and improve quality of life, and crucially, to prevent future, more serious cardiovascular events like heart attacks and strokes. Achieving these goals requires a nuanced understanding of medication classes and their appropriate application.
The Arsenal of Angina Medications: A Deep Dive
Angina medications can be broadly categorized by their mechanism of action: those that relieve acute symptoms, and those that work to prevent future events by addressing the underlying cardiovascular risk factors.
1. Fast-Acting Relief: Nitrates
Nitrates are the cornerstone for immediate angina relief. They work by relaxing and widening blood vessels, particularly the coronary arteries, which increases blood flow to the heart and reduces the heart’s workload.
- Nitroglycerin (NTG): This is the most common fast-acting nitrate. It comes in various forms:
- Sublingual Tablets: Placed under the tongue, these dissolve quickly, providing relief within minutes. They are typically used at the onset of angina or preventatively before activities known to trigger angina.
-
Buccal Spray: Sprayed onto or under the tongue, this offers similar rapid absorption and action to sublingual tablets.
-
Mechanism in Action: Imagine a garden hose with a kink. Nitroglycerin is like unkinking that hose, allowing water (blood) to flow freely, easing the strain on the pump (heart).
-
Important Considerations:
- Storage: Nitroglycerin tablets are sensitive to light, heat, and moisture. They should be stored in their original dark glass bottle and replaced every 3-6 months after opening, as they lose potency.
-
Side Effects: Common side effects include headache, dizziness, flushing, and lightheadedness due to blood pressure drop. Taking it while sitting or lying down can help mitigate dizziness.
-
Interactions: Critically, nitrates should never be taken with erectile dysfunction medications containing sildenafil (Viagra), tadalafil (Cialis), or vardenafil (Levitra), as this can lead to a dangerous and potentially fatal drop in blood pressure.
-
Action Plan: Always carry your nitroglycerin. If angina symptoms occur, stop activity, rest, and take one dose. If symptoms persist after 5 minutes, take a second dose. If still present after another 5 minutes (third dose), seek emergency medical attention immediately. This isn’t just for stable angina; any new or worsening chest pain, especially if it doesn’t respond to nitroglycerin, warrants immediate emergency care.
2. Long-Term Symptom Control and Prevention: Anti-Anginal Medications
These medications are taken regularly to reduce the frequency and severity of angina attacks and to improve overall heart health.
- Beta-Blockers:
- How They Work: Beta-blockers (e.g., metoprolol, carvedilol, atenolol) reduce the heart rate and the force of heart muscle contractions, thereby decreasing the heart’s oxygen demand. They also help to regulate blood pressure. Think of it as putting a gentle brake on the heart, allowing it to work more efficiently and with less stress.
-
Examples in Action: If your angina is triggered by climbing stairs, a beta-blocker might reduce your heart rate during that activity, preventing the oxygen demand from exceeding supply.
-
Indications: Often first-line therapy for stable angina, especially if you also have high blood pressure, a history of heart attack, or certain arrhythmias.
-
Side Effects: Fatigue, dizziness, slow heart rate, cold hands and feet, and sometimes shortness of breath (especially in individuals with asthma or certain lung conditions).
-
Key Considerations: Should not be stopped abruptly, as this can worsen angina or trigger a heart attack.
-
Calcium Channel Blockers (CCBs):
- How They Work: CCBs (e.g., amlodipine, diltiazem, verapamil) relax and widen blood vessels, increasing blood flow to the heart. Some also slow the heart rate and reduce its pumping force. They are effective in treating both stable and variant (Prinzmetal’s) angina.
-
Examples in Action: For Prinzmetal’s angina, where arterial spasms are the culprit, CCBs directly counter this constriction, allowing blood to flow unimpeded. For stable angina, they expand the vessels, increasing oxygen delivery.
-
Indications: Used when beta-blockers are not tolerated, contraindicated, or if angina symptoms persist despite beta-blocker use. They are particularly useful for variant angina and individuals with high blood pressure.
-
Side Effects: Swelling in the ankles/feet, headache, dizziness, flushing, and constipation (especially with verapamil).
-
Ranolazine:
- How It Works: Ranolazine works by altering the heart muscle’s electrical activity, specifically by inhibiting a late sodium current, which improves the heart’s efficiency without significantly affecting heart rate or blood pressure. It’s like fine-tuning the heart’s internal machinery to optimize its oxygen use.
-
Indications: Often used as an add-on therapy for chronic stable angina when other medications haven’t provided sufficient relief, or as a stand-alone option if other anti-anginals are not tolerated.
-
Side Effects: Dizziness, constipation, nausea, and headache.
-
Key Considerations: Can interact with certain other medications, so a thorough review of all current medications is essential.
3. Preventing Future Cardiovascular Events: Protective Medications
These medications don’t directly alleviate angina symptoms but are crucial for addressing the underlying causes of CAD and preventing progression to more severe conditions.
- Antiplatelet Agents:
- How They Work: These medications (e.g., aspirin, clopidogrel, ticagrelor) make blood platelets less sticky, preventing them from clumping together to form dangerous blood clots that can block arteries and lead to heart attacks or strokes.
-
Aspirin Example: A low-dose aspirin daily is a common recommendation for many individuals with angina, acting as a preventative measure against clot formation in narrowed arteries.
-
Indications: Generally recommended for all patients with diagnosed CAD or at high risk of cardiovascular events, unless contraindicated.
-
Side Effects: Increased risk of bleeding, stomach upset, and ulcers.
-
Key Considerations: Discuss with your doctor before starting aspirin, especially if you have a history of bleeding problems or are taking other blood thinners.
-
Statins (Cholesterol-Lowering Medications):
- How They Work: Statins (e.g., atorvastatin, simvastatin, rosuvastatin) reduce the production of cholesterol in the liver and help the body remove existing LDL (“bad”) cholesterol from the blood. They also have anti-inflammatory effects that can stabilize plaque in arteries, reducing the risk of plaque rupture and clot formation.
-
Example: A high cholesterol level contributes to the plaque buildup that causes angina. A statin helps shrink or stabilize that plaque, reducing the risk of further narrowing.
-
Indications: Recommended for most individuals with CAD or high cholesterol to reduce the risk of heart attacks and strokes.
-
Side Effects: Muscle pain, liver enzyme elevation, and digestive issues.
-
ACE Inhibitors (Angiotensin-Converting Enzyme Inhibitors) and ARBs (Angiotensin Receptor Blockers):
- How They Work: These medications (e.g., lisinopril, ramipril for ACE inhibitors; losartan, valsartan for ARBs) relax blood vessels, lower blood pressure, and reduce the workload on the heart. They also offer protective benefits for the kidneys and heart muscle.
-
Examples: If you have angina along with high blood pressure or diabetes, an ACE inhibitor or ARB can address both conditions, offering comprehensive cardiovascular protection.
-
Indications: Especially beneficial for individuals with angina who also have high blood pressure, diabetes, heart failure, or kidney disease.
-
Side Effects: Dry cough (more common with ACE inhibitors), dizziness, and elevated potassium levels.
Choosing Wisely: A Personalized Approach
The “wisely” in “choosing angina medication wisely” hinges on a highly personalized assessment. There’s no universal best drug; the optimal choice depends on a careful consideration of individual patient characteristics.
1. Type of Angina and Severity:
- Stable Angina: Initial focus is on beta-blockers or calcium channel blockers for symptom control, along with aspirin and statins for prevention. Nitroglycerin for acute relief.
-
Unstable Angina: This is an emergency. Treatment is aggressive and often involves a combination of antiplatelets, anticoagulants, nitrates, and beta-blockers, with a strong consideration for immediate revascularization (e.g., angioplasty and stenting).
-
Variant Angina: Calcium channel blockers are typically the first-line choice, as they directly address the arterial spasms. Nitrates can also be used.
2. Co-existing Medical Conditions (Comorbidities):
Your overall health picture significantly influences medication choice.
- High Blood Pressure (Hypertension): Beta-blockers, calcium channel blockers, ACE inhibitors, and ARBs all effectively manage both angina and hypertension. A single medication can often address multiple issues.
-
Diabetes: ACE inhibitors/ARBs and statins are particularly beneficial due to their protective effects on the heart and kidneys in diabetic patients. Some beta-blockers might mask signs of low blood sugar, requiring careful monitoring.
-
Heart Failure: Certain beta-blockers (e.g., carvedilol, metoprolol succinate) and ACE inhibitors/ARBs are crucial for managing heart failure and can also help with angina.
-
Chronic Kidney Disease: ACE inhibitors and ARBs are often preferred as they offer renal protection.
-
Asthma or COPD: Beta-blockers can worsen breathing problems in some individuals with these conditions. Calcium channel blockers or ranolazine might be more suitable alternatives.
-
Peripheral Artery Disease (PAD): Antiplatelet agents are important for reducing cardiovascular event risk in PAD.
3. Potential Side Effects and Drug Interactions:
Every medication carries the risk of side effects. Your doctor will weigh the benefits against potential adverse reactions.
- Headaches with Nitrates: If severe, discuss with your doctor. Sometimes, lowering the dose or trying a different formulation can help.
-
Fatigue with Beta-Blockers: This can impact quality of life. Exploring alternative beta-blockers or switching to a different class of medication might be necessary.
-
Muscle Pain with Statins: While rare, statin-induced muscle pain can be debilitating. Your doctor might try a different statin or explore non-statin cholesterol-lowering options.
-
Digestive Issues: Many medications can cause stomach upset, constipation, or diarrhea. Addressing these with dietary changes or adjunctive medications can improve adherence.
-
Drug-Drug Interactions: This is a critical point. Always provide your healthcare provider with a complete list of all medications you are taking, including over-the-counter drugs, supplements, and herbal remedies. For instance, the dangerous interaction between nitrates and erectile dysfunction drugs is a prime example of why this is paramount. Similarly, certain antibiotics can interact with statins, increasing the risk of muscle problems.

Beyond Medications: The Power of Lifestyle
Medications are powerful tools, but they are most effective when coupled with a heart-healthy lifestyle. These changes not only complement your medication but can also significantly reduce your reliance on them and improve overall cardiovascular health.
- Smoking Cessation: If you smoke, quitting is the single most impactful step you can take for your heart health. Smoking damages blood vessels, accelerates atherosclerosis, and increases the heart’s oxygen demand.
-
Healthy Diet: Embrace a diet rich in fruits, vegetables, whole grains, lean proteins, and healthy fats. Limit saturated and trans fats, cholesterol, sodium, and added sugars. This helps manage blood pressure, cholesterol, and weight.
-
Regular Physical Activity: Aim for at least 150 minutes of moderate-intensity aerobic exercise per week. Exercise strengthens the heart, improves blood flow, and helps control weight, blood pressure, and cholesterol. Always discuss exercise plans with your doctor, especially if you have angina. They can help you determine a safe and effective activity level.
-
Weight Management: Maintaining a healthy weight reduces the strain on your heart and lowers the risk of developing or worsening conditions like high blood pressure and diabetes, which contribute to angina.
-
Stress Management: Chronic stress can exacerbate angina. Practice stress-reducing techniques such as meditation, yoga, deep breathing exercises, or spending time in nature.
-
Blood Pressure and Cholesterol Control: Adhere to your medication and lifestyle recommendations to keep your blood pressure and cholesterol within healthy ranges. Regular monitoring is key.
-
Diabetes Management: If you have diabetes, strict control of your blood sugar levels is crucial to prevent further damage to blood vessels and reduce cardiovascular risk.
-
Limit Alcohol: Excessive alcohol consumption can raise blood pressure and contribute to other heart problems. If you drink, do so in moderation.
-
Adequate Sleep: Aim for 7-9 hours of quality sleep per night. Poor sleep can negatively impact heart health.
Monitoring and Adjusting Your Treatment Plan
Angina management is an ongoing process. Your treatment plan isn’t set in stone; it will evolve as your condition changes and as you respond to medications.
- Regular Follow-ups: Schedule regular appointments with your cardiologist or primary care physician to monitor your symptoms, blood pressure, heart rate, cholesterol levels, and overall health.
-
Symptom Diary: Keeping a diary of your angina episodes (when they occur, what triggers them, how long they last, what relieves them) can provide invaluable information to your doctor for adjusting your medication.
-
Medication Adherence: Take your medications exactly as prescribed. Missing doses or stopping medications prematurely can have serious consequences. If side effects are an issue, discuss them with your doctor rather than stopping the medication.
-
Adjusting Doses or Medications: Based on your symptoms, side effects, and monitoring results, your doctor may adjust medication dosages, switch to different medications within the same class, or add new medications to your regimen. This iterative process aims to find the most effective and well-tolerated combination.
-
Recognizing Worsening Angina: It’s critical to know the signs of unstable angina or a potential heart attack. If your angina changes in pattern (occurs at rest, is more severe, lasts longer, doesn’t respond to nitroglycerin), seek immediate medical attention.
When to Seek Immediate Medical Attention
While this guide focuses on choosing medication wisely, it’s paramount to know when angina signals an emergency. Call emergency services immediately if you experience:
- New or worsening chest pain that is severe, lasts longer than a few minutes, or does not go away with rest or nitroglycerin.
-
Chest pain that spreads to your arm, neck, jaw, back, or stomach.
-
Chest pain accompanied by shortness of breath, sweating, nausea, dizziness, or a feeling of impending doom.
-
Any symptoms that you suspect could be a heart attack.
